Ada Tornado History

This location page summarizes tornado records that list Ada, Oklahoma as a begin or end location. The dataset includes 9 matching records from 2001 through 2025. The strongest matching rating is EF1 (Moderate damage), the latest matching tornado is April 19, 2025, and minimum reported property damage totals $10.9M.

Notable Tornado Records

The table highlights the strongest and most damaging records in this page's local dataset. Damage totals are NOAA-reported minimum estimates where available.

DateRatingAreaLengthWidthDeathsInjuriesMin. property damage
March 4, 2025EF1Pontotoc, Oklahoma3.7 mi200 yd01$10.0M
April 19, 2025EF1Pontotoc, Oklahoma4.3 mi100 yd01$750K
October 10, 2021EF1Pontotoc, Oklahoma7.31 mi300 yd00$100K
May 21, 2011EF1Pontotoc, Oklahoma3.3 mi150 yd00N/A
May 15, 2013EF0Pontotoc, Oklahoma0.5 mi50 yd00$20K
March 26, 2017EF0Pontotoc, Oklahoma4 mi50 yd00$1K
June 24, 2018EF0Pontotoc, Oklahoma0.2 mi10 yd00$1K
May 20, 2001F0Pontotoc, Oklahoma0.3 mi25 yd00N/A
May 23, 2015EF0Pontotoc, Oklahoma0.2 mi20 yd00N/A
